University of Houston Sales Associate Salaries in Boulder

The average University of Houston Sales Associate in Boulder earns an estimated $69,442 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$56,254 with a $13,188 bonus. University of Houston's Sales Associate compensation is $11,590 more than the US average for a Sales Associate. Sales Associate salaries at University of Houston in Boulder can range from $30,000 - $200,000.

In Boulder, The Sales Department at University of Houston earns $9,698 more on average than the HR Department.
